People buy insurance to have peace of mind that if a loss occurs, the devastation, disruption and financial setbacks from the loss are minimized. The insurance premium pays for a conditional promise for the insurance company to pay for a loss if a loss occurs that is covered by the policy. When the insurance company breaks that promise and denies your claim, fails to pay what you are owed, and/or unreasonably delays the payment, you may have a case that involves:

 

  • Insurance coverage disputes
  • Breach of contract
  • Insurance bad faith
  • Insurance Fair Conduct Act (“IFCA”)
  • Consumer Protection Act (“CPA”)
